aboutsummaryrefslogtreecommitdiffstats
path: root/src/servo/layout/layout_task.rs
diff options
context:
space:
mode:
authorJosh Matthews <josh@joshmatthews.net>2012-12-23 13:42:24 -0500
committerJosh Matthews <josh@joshmatthews.net>2012-12-23 13:43:33 -0500
commitbe1935e9ad499f053521cbb5e2721fdfacff84f5 (patch)
tree5c3d7e6d0d47b708e27e8e03a81126abd166668f /src/servo/layout/layout_task.rs
parent157227e8c24c45e93ad65571d5df8b52e2c19a85 (diff)
downloadservo-be1935e9ad499f053521cbb5e2721fdfacff84f5.tar.gz
servo-be1935e9ad499f053521cbb5e2721fdfacff84f5.zip
Update for language changes.
Diffstat (limited to 'src/servo/layout/layout_task.rs')
-rw-r--r--src/servo/layout/layout_task.rs13
1 files changed, 7 insertions, 6 deletions
diff --git a/src/servo/layout/layout_task.rs b/src/servo/layout/layout_task.rs
index 664c20a481f..093bb028055 100644
--- a/src/servo/layout/layout_task.rs
+++ b/src/servo/layout/layout_task.rs
@@ -15,8 +15,9 @@ use layout::traverse::*;
use resource::image_cache_task::{ImageCacheTask, ImageResponseMsg};
use resource::local_image_cache::LocalImageCache;
use util::time::time;
+use util::task::spawn_listener;
-use core::comm::*; // FIXME: Bad! Pipe-ify me.
+use core::oldcomm::*; // FIXME: Bad! Pipe-ify me.
use core::dvec::DVec;
use core::mutable::Mut;
use core::task::*;
@@ -38,7 +39,7 @@ use std::arc::ARC;
use std::cell::Cell;
use std::net::url::Url;
-pub type LayoutTask = comm::Chan<Msg>;
+pub type LayoutTask = oldcomm::Chan<Msg>;
pub enum LayoutQuery {
ContentBox(Node)
@@ -53,7 +54,7 @@ enum LayoutQueryResponse_ {
pub enum Msg {
AddStylesheet(Stylesheet),
BuildMsg(BuildData),
- QueryMsg(LayoutQuery, comm::Chan<LayoutQueryResponse>),
+ QueryMsg(LayoutQuery, oldcomm::Chan<LayoutQueryResponse>),
ExitMsg
}
@@ -96,7 +97,7 @@ struct Layout {
render_task: RenderTask,
image_cache_task: ImageCacheTask,
local_image_cache: @LocalImageCache,
- from_content: comm::Port<Msg>,
+ from_content: oldcomm::Port<Msg>,
font_ctx: @FontContext,
// This is used to root auxilliary RCU reader data
@@ -106,7 +107,7 @@ struct Layout {
fn Layout(render_task: RenderTask,
image_cache_task: ImageCacheTask,
- from_content: comm::Port<Msg>,
+ from_content: oldcomm::Port<Msg>,
opts: &Opts) -> Layout {
let fctx = @FontContext::new(opts.render_backend, true);
@@ -251,7 +252,7 @@ impl Layout {
fn handle_query(query: LayoutQuery,
- reply_chan: comm::Chan<LayoutQueryResponse>) {
+ reply_chan: oldcomm::Chan<LayoutQueryResponse>) {
match query {
ContentBox(node) => {
let response = do node.aux |a| {